如何处理区块链上的用户身份验证问题?
在当今数字化时代,区块链技术正在逐渐成为用户身份验证领域的重要工具。区块链的去中心化特性提供了一种新的方法来验证用户身份,从而提升了安全性和隐私保护的水平。通过运用密码学、智能合约和去中心化身份技术,用户能够在没有中介的情况下验证自己的身份。这一技术的应用不仅对金融行业产生影响,其他领域如医疗、社交媒体和在线服务同样受益于这一创新。区块链可以通过创建一个分布式的身份验证网络来解决传统身份验证中的许多问题。在传统的系统中,用户的个人信息通常存储在中心化的服务器上,这使其容易受到黑客攻击和泄露。而区块链则通过加密技术将用户的数据分散存储在众多节点上,这种结构极大增强了数据的安全性。只有持有私钥的用户才能访问和管理他们的信息,从而降低了身份盗窃和数据篡改的风险。在这个分布式网络中,用户可以生成自己的去中心化身份(DID),该身份在区块链上被永久记录,难以被更改或删除。这种新的身份验证方法不再依赖于传统的用户名和密码,用户可以通过生物识别、双因素认证等多种方式进行身份确认。比如,智能手机的指纹识别或面部识别技术可以与区块链相结合,以提供更安全的身份验证。这及其便利性使得用户能够在不同平台间轻松游走,而无需频繁输入个人信息。与此同时,区块链上存储的信息具有高度透明性,所有交易和身份验证过程都可以被参与者实时查看。这种透明性加强了信任,用户可以确认某个身份是否已经过验证,有效防止欺诈行为。在某些情况下,用户还可以选择向特定方公开信息,从而实现数据的最小化披露。这一特性可以有效保护用户的隐私,使得身份验证过程既安全又便捷。在实施这些技术时,需要面对一些挑战。例如,如何确保用户界面的友好性,以及如何有效管理用户的私钥和恢复机制,都是需要关注的问题。用户一般并不具备区块链技术的知识,复杂的操作步骤可能导致使用障碍。因此,在设计用户界面时,应保证其简单直观,以提高用户的接受度与使用体验。同时,为了防止用户丢失私钥,需强化教育和工具的提供,使用户了解如何安全地存储这些关键信息。智能合约在身份验证中也发挥了重要作用。通过设定特定条件,智能合约能够在身份验证成功时自动执行某些操作,如解锁账户或授予访问权限。这样的自动化过程不仅降低了人为错误的风险,也提高了效率。用户在完成身份验证的同时,系统可以立即响应,减少等待时间,提高整体用户体验。不可否认,区块链带来的身份验证解决方案并非一成不变。在实施过程中,需要不断对技术进行更新和优化,以应对潜在的安全威胁。随着攻击技术的演进,区块链也必须不断进行安全审查,确保其能够抵御各种新出现的攻击方式。这要求从业者具备前瞻性的视角,持续关注行业动态,以便及时调整安全策略。法律和合规问题也是一个需要考虑的重要方面。不同国家和地区对于数据保护和隐私权有各自的法律框架。在区块链上记录用户身份信息时,必须遵循相关的法律法规,确保用户的权益得到妥善保护。这可能需要与法规制定者积极合作,确保所使用的身份验证技术既符合行业标准,也能满足法律要求。如上所述,区块链的应用在用户身份验证领域具有显著的潜力,特别是在提高安全性和隐私保护的能力方面。各行各业均应密切关注这一技术的发展,以便及时采用最佳实践来满足未来的需求。随着这项技术的成熟,用户将体验到更安全、便捷的身份验证方式,同时享受更高的隐私保障。
ChainSafeAI(链熵科技)专注于区块链生态安全,以“数据驱动 + 技术赋能”构建360°全方位安全防护体系,服务于交易所、金融机构、OTC服务商及加密资产投资者。公司提供覆盖KYT风险监测、智能合约审计、加密资产追踪、区块链漏洞测试等在内的全维度安全与合规技术解决方案,助力客户防范洗钱、诈骗等风险,保障业务合规运行。通过实时风险预警、合规审查与资金溯源分析,协助客户识别链上异常行为、防范洗钱及诈骗风险、降低被盗损失并提升资产追回可能性。